Output d21b521bbf67b960e34e337c5c5bc3cab13561d25ee0b6b40f92c8ea0905c98a:0

value
995856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c215c4c871ef4ff1f1f8aa12b0a12a2c5ed4ac9 OP_EQUALVERIFY OP_CHECKSIG
address
13ZjtJYG7XBMyBk6fdNkPK1qGCRhtHfVLf
transaction
d21b521bbf67b960e34e337c5c5bc3cab13561d25ee0b6b40f92c8ea0905c98a
confirmations
343652
spent
true